At a time when many are questioning whether we need offices at all, photographer Steven Ahlgren's archival images of American workplaces are a reminder of a not-too-distant past.

Among US workers able to perform their jobs from home, almost six in 10 now do so most, or all, of the time, according to a Pew Research Centerpublished in February. Of those, only 42% cite the coronavirus as a major reason, with over three-quarters saying they simply prefer it.
